Baldor Servo Drive FD2A02TR-RN20 Specification

  • Power Factor
  • >0.98
  • Rated Current
  • 6.5A
  • Current Range
  • 0-8A
  • Phase
  • Three Phase
  • Output Current
  • 6.5A
  • Connector Type
  • Screw terminals
  • Cooling Method
  • Forced air cooling
  • Rated Power
  • 2 kW
  • Features
  • Digital interface, fault diagnostics, precise motion control, compact design
  • Output Type
  • AC
  • Working Temperature
  • 0C to +40C
  • Noise Level
  • < 55 dB
  • Power Supply
  • 200-230V AC, 50/60Hz
  • Application
  • Industrial automation, robotics, CNC machinery
  • Operating Temperature
  • 0C to +40C
  • Product Type
  • Servo Drive
  • Output Power
  • 2 kW
  • Output Frequency
  • 0-400 Hz
  • Input Voltage
  • 200-230 VAC
  • Voltage Protection
  • Overvoltage and undervoltage protection
  • Efficiency
  • High efficiency (typically >90%)
  • Material
  • Robust industrial-grade enclosure
  • Line Regulation
  • < 0.5%
  • Storage Temperature
  • -40C to +85C
  • Weight
  • Approx. 4.5 kg
